If more than one responder is available and trained in cpr, when should the responders switch? select all that apply.
Kay [80]

They switch roles after every five cycles CPR or about every two minutes.

<h3>What is CPR?</h3>

The term CPR is the acronym for cardiopulmonary resuscitation. It is an important first aid that is administered to a person that has a sudden heart attack.

If more than one  responder is available and trained in CPR, they switch roles after every five cycles CPR or about every two minutes.
